LoslegenKostenlos loslegen

Formelnotation

Neben der vars()-Notation, mit der du festlegst, welche Variablen zum Aufteilen des Datensatzes in Facetten verwendet werden, gibt es auch eine klassische Formelnotation. Die drei Fälle sind in der Tabelle gezeigt.

| Moderne Notation                           | Formelnotation     |
|--------------------------------------------|--------------------|
| facet_grid(rows = vars(A))                 | facet_grid(A ~ .)  |
| facet_grid(cols = vars(B))                 | facet_grid(. ~ B)  |
| facet_grid(rows = vars(A), cols = vars(B)) | facet_grid(A ~ B)  |

mpg_by_wt ist wieder verfügbar. Erstelle die vorherigen Plots neu, diesmal mit der Formelnotation.

Diese Übung ist Teil des Kurses

Fortgeschrittene Datenvisualisierung mit ggplot2

Kurs anzeigen

Interaktive Übung

Vervollständige den Beispielcode, um diese Übung erfolgreich abzuschließen.

ggplot(mtcars, aes(wt, mpg)) + 
  geom_point() +
  # Facet rows by am using formula notation
  ___
Code bearbeiten und ausführen